连接Linux的常用工具

在现代科技的快速发展中,Linux作为一种自由开源的操作系统得到了广泛应用。对于使用者而言,掌握一些连接Linux的常用工具是非常重要的。这些工具不仅能够提高工作效率,还能够增强系统管理的能力。本文将介绍一些与连接Linux相关的常用工具。

首先,SSH(Secure Shell)是连接Linux系统最常用的工具之一。SSH通过安全加密的方式,使得用户可以远程登录到Linux系统,并在远程终端中执行命令。这种方式在远程服务器管理和文件传输方面非常方便。使用SSH的时候,我们可以通过密钥认证来提高系统的安全性。

其次,Telnet是一种早期的远程登录协议,它在网络早期风靡一时,但由于其不具备加密功能,所以安全性较差,因此在现代网络环境中使用越来越少。然而,由于某些特殊需求,仍有一些用户会使用Telnet连接Linux系统。

除了远程登录,SCP(Secure Copy)也是一个非常常用的工具。SCP基于SSH协议,可以在远程系统之间进行文件传输。与FTP相比,SCP具有更好的安全性,也更加适合在远程系统之间进行文件传输。在进行服务器之间的文件同步或备份时,可以使用SCP来保证数据的传输安全。

为了提高Linux系统的监控和管理能力,我们还可以使用一些工具来连接并接收系统日志。其中,最常用的工具是Syslog。Syslog是一个系统日志的标准,它可以将日志信息通过UDP或TCP协议发送到远程服务器。通过配置Syslog,我们可以集中管理多台Linux服务器的日志信息,便于日志的统一分析和监控。

除了Syslog外,还有一些特定功能的工具,如rsync和cron。rsync是一个强大的文件同步工具,可以在本地系统与远程系统之间同步文件。cron是一个定时任务管理工具,可以帮助我们在指定的时间自动执行特定的任务。

另外,对于出于安全性考虑的系统管理员来说,防火墙是必不可少的工具之一。Linux系统默认提供了iptables防火墙,可以对网络流量进行过滤和管理。通过配置iptables规则,我们可以控制网络访问,保护系统的安全。

最后,一些版本的Linux操作系统提供了Web控制台工具,如Webmin和cPanel。这些工具提供了图形界面,使得用户可以通过Web浏览器连接到Linux系统进行管理。这对于不熟悉命令行操作的用户非常有帮助。

总结来说,连接Linux的常用工具涵盖了远程登录、文件传输、日志管理、定时任务、防火墙等方面。通过掌握这些工具,用户可以更加方便地管理和监控Linux系统,提高工作效率。当然,根据实际需求不同,还有很多其他的工具可以使用。探索和熟练使用这些工具,将使得我们的Linux系统管理更加得心应手。